Hello Mr Casey. My hubby and I were shoes makers back in the late 70s - 80s. We worked for H&M Rayne. The Queen’s shoemaker’s. We were based near Kings x. I was one of two heel coverers. My hubby stitched the shoes. He also made hand bags for The Late Queen Elizabeth and Princess Diana. We didn’t appreciate it at the time but it is a legacy we are very proud of. It was fascinating watching you making shoes. We still have some of the tools used back then. You are right, there is a real difference in factory made shoes and bespoke. At Rayne, we did both.
